Why Strong Passwords Matter
Every time you create an account online—whether it’s for social media, email, or banking—you’re asked to set a password. The problem is that humans are not naturally good at remembering complicated strings of characters, so many end up reusing the same login details across multiple sites. This bad habit increases the risk of a single breach exposing all of your online identities.
Cybercriminals often rely on tactics such as brute force attacks, dictionary hacks, and phishing schemes to steal access. A strong, randomly generated password significantly reduces the chance of being compromised.
What Makes a Good Password?
Before discussing online tools, it’s important to understand what makes a password truly secure. Experts recommend:
At least 12–16 characters in length
A mix of uppercase, lowercase, numbers, and special symbols
Avoiding common words, names, or birth dates
Not using sequential patterns like 12345 or qwerty
While these rules may seem simple, following them consistently for every account is not. That’s where an automated generator becomes a valuable ally.
How the Norton Password Generator Works
The Norton Password Generator helps users instantly create strong and unique login credentials with a single click. Instead of struggling to come up with a secure idea on your own, you can simply choose settings such as password length, character types, and complexity level. The tool then produces a completely random string that hackers cannot easily guess.
Another advantage is that you can generate as many variations as needed, which is especially useful if you manage multiple accounts for work and personal use. Pairing this tool with a password manager makes online security even more convenient since you won’t need to memorize each login.

Best Practices for Managing Passwords
While a generator is a great first step, the real challenge lies in managing multiple accounts. Here are some tips:
Use a reputable password manager to securely store and autofill your credentials.
Never share your passwords via email or chat apps.
Regularly update your login details, especially for sensitive accounts like banking or healthcare.
